Output 9d665b4e91d4415409959ea1a95da074dc74b2fdc2dda56701ab336a4870d867:0

value
1590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6facc2a7c0158b8ba5902355a214de44b1b546f8 OP_EQUAL
address
3BsVtSMmkPMzzxVC2XmPz4AEWghzFs73Ue
transaction
9d665b4e91d4415409959ea1a95da074dc74b2fdc2dda56701ab336a4870d867
confirmations
319382
spent
false